Home to 7,179 residents, Fall River County is one of South Dakota's counties. 10 cities and places have their primary county here. The median household income of $61,056 is below the South Dakota median ($72,421).
From 2019 to 2023, Fall River County's population grew 6.4% from 6,747 to 7,179, while its median household income rose 20.7% from $50,588 to $61,056.
White (non-Hispanic) residents are the largest group, 84.4% of the population. 76.4% of workers drive to work alone.

| Year | Population | Median household income | Median home value | Median gross rent |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2019 | 6,747 | $50,588 | $129,400 | $608 |
| 2020 | 6,721 | $51,383 | $136,800 | $797 |
| 2021 | 6,979 | $51,007 | $136,400 | $756 |
| 2022 | 7,079 | $54,886 | $158,500 | $813 |
| 2023 | 7,179 | $61,056 | $176,300 | $866 |
Each year is a US Census Bureau ACS 5-year estimate ending that year.
